Reddit Reports A 75% Boost In Q1 Ad Revenue As It Reaches For 100 Million Daily US Users
Generative AI has pushed traffic off a cliff across most of the internet, but not on social platforms. Reddit included. Reddit’s global average daily users increased by 17% year over year in Q1 to 126.8 million. In the US, daily users were up 7% YOY to a total of 53.5 million. Patreon is prioritizing discovery. New short-form posts called Quips are part of the plan.
Back in 2024, Patreon announced its plan to bring a greater "network effect" to its platform. By introducing new features that help active patrons find other accounts that might interest them, Patreon furthered its mission to serve as an all-in-one creator hub. Now, all Patreon users can be part of the platform's network. Existing discovery features are rolling out more widely, and Patreon is adding some new tools as well, including a short-form content format titled Quips. Visit Tubefilter for more great stories.
